"Rebel Spirit Music Reviews"

D.C.-bred (by way of India) Tejas Singh was heavily influenced by the popular jam bands of his adolescence, and it shows on his EP “A Brief History.” The singer/songwriter’s vocals are Ben Harper and Ray LaMontagne-inspired in their shaky but strong delivery while his uptempo instrumentals combine racing rhythms with bluegrass, soul, and R&B. Singh’s tracks seem tailor-made for alternately frantic and free-flowing dance moves in college venues or outdoor festivals. While his influences are easy to spot, Singh asserts his individuality on his lyrics which are poignant and relevant. On “A Brief History” Singh frankly tackles race (“white man came on a wooden ship/black man could not believe his eyes/white man crammed his ships with everyone that he could fit/continuing his crimes/you cannot take me, I will not go”), while on “The Rescue,” he points a finger at society and government (“mother culture spoke into my ear/she said you’re young and rich and you have nothing to fear” and “are you conscious of a careless government/are you part of it”). On “Ghosts” Singh contemplates the plight of the artist (“artists are just ghosts/people like us disappear,” questions the economy of the country (“everyone is profiting from things this country stole”), and ultimately applies delightfully adolescent existentialism to the plight (“you will die/but you can’t take all your gold/so buy me a beer and let’s get stoned”). Singh’s appeal lies in his ability to deliver to both the zoned-out jam set and the contemplative critic. - Rebel Spirit Music

Bio

Tejas Singh is an Indian born singer songwriter who grew up outside of D.C. and now lives in New York City. He is a versatile songwriter and front man, capable of producing original material in both a solo and full band setting. He draw s on songwriters such as Elliot Smith, Ben Folds, Jack Johnson and John Mayer, absorbing their senses of melody and song structure, yet never losing his ability to produce strongly original material, both familiar and unique.

His first official release came in May of 2007, shortly after moving to New York to pursue music full time. The EP, A Brief History, is a six song record running just over twenty minutes that explores some of his more recent musical influences, with up tempo blue grass beats and a lyrical overtone that is socially and politically conscious without being contrived or preachy. With a repertoire of over fifty original songs, it is sure to be the first of many recordings from this young artist, who may yet prove to be one of the next members in the long line of great contemporary songwriters.
